`
yangyangmyself
  • 浏览: 229661 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论
文章列表
引用   本实例可以根据具体OID采集到相关设备的信息,也可以遍例设备所有信息。先在本机启用    SNMP协议,并设置PUBLIC字符串; 若不清楚系统设备OID(包括交换机、路由器等设备)    可以下载工具"MG-SOFT+MIB+Browse"查询OID,以下类为一个工具类: package com.sunshine.monitor.comm.quart.util; import java.io.ByteArrayInputStream; import java.io.IOException; import java.util.Collect ...
引用   利用FLEX组件嵌入JSP页面中并获取FLEX变量值传递到JSP变量,提交给后台JAVA Web   应用程序处理,本实例是将FLEX Numeric滑动值传递给JSP后台。    以下是将FLEX集成到J2EE说明:   ******************************* *   Introduction              * ******************************* The Flex compiler module for J2EE application servers is a Web Application aRchive ( ...
Java多线程同步 锁机制分析   打个比方:一个object就像一个大房子,大门永远打开。房子里有很多房间(也就是方法)。这些房间有上锁的(synchronized方法), 和不上锁之分(普通方法)。房门口放着一把钥匙(key),这把钥匙可以打开所有上锁的房间。另外我把所有想调用该对象方法的线程比喻成想进入这房子某个 房间的人。所有的东西就这么多了,下面我们看看这些东西之间如何作用的。 在此我们先来明确一下我们的前提条件。该对象至少有一个synchronized方法,否则这个key还有啥意义。当然也就不会有我们的这个主题了。
文法是一个四元组:G = {VT,VN,S,P}      其中VT是一个非空有限的符号集合,它的每个元素成为终结符号。VN也是一个非空有限的符号集合,它的每个元素称为非终结符号,并且VT∩VN=Φ。S∈VN,称为文法G的开始符号。P是一个非空有限集合,它的元素称为产生式。所谓产生式,其形式为α→β,α称为产生式的左部,β称为产生式的右部,符号“→”表示“定义为”,并且α、β∈(VT∪VN)*,α≠ε,即α、β是由终结符和非终结符组成的符号串。开始符S必须至少在某一产生式的左部出现一次。另外可以对形式α→β,α→γ的产生式缩写为α→β|γ,以方便书写。      注:一般以大写字母表示非终结 ...
命令模式 写道 命令模式适应于一组对象他们的操作形式非常的类似,这个时候我们可以把对象的行为进行抽象,抽象成命令对象,实现请求与处理解耦。 一般情况下如下几类场景中使用命令模式: 1、当一个应用程序调用者与多个目标对象之间存在调用关系时,并且目标对象之间的操作很类似的时候。 2、例如当一个目标对象内部的方法调用太复杂,或者内部的方法需要协作才能完成对象的某个特点操作时。 命令模式有哪些角色组成: 命令角色:声明执行操作接口,由抽象类或接口实现。 具体抽象角色:将一个接收者绑定一个动作,调用接收者相应操作,以实现命令角色声明的执行操作的接口。 请求者角色:调用命令对象执行这个请求。 接收者 ...
引用模板类 /* * Copyright 2002-2007 the original author or authors. * * Licensed under the Apache License, Version 2.0 (the "License"); * you may not use this file except in compliance with the License. * You may obtain a copy of the License at * * http://www.apache.org/licen ...

UML之类图关系

    博客分类:
  • Java
类图关系 写道 1.继承关系(Generalization) 2.实现关系(Realization) 3.依赖关系(Dependency) 4.关联关系(Association) 5.有方向的关联(DirectedAssociation) 6.聚合关系(Aggregation) 7.组合关系(Composition)  继承关系(Generalization):     继承指的是一个类(称为子类、子接口)继承另外的一个类(称为父类、父接口)的功能,并可以增加它自己的新功能的能力,继承是类与类或者接口与接口 之间最常见的关系之一;在Java中此类关系通过关键字extends明确标识 ...
引用 BIRT WebSphere 6.0.1 Deployment This entry explains how to deploy the WebViewerExample contained in the BIRT 2.6.2 runtime as an ear file using WebSphere Application Server, Version 6.0.1.0. 【注意】:websphere 6.0.1 不支持高于版本birt 3.7(现在最新版birt4.2),夸版 本的报表文件,无法正常运行,但是只要修改报表文件(**.rptdesign)首部的版本即可兼 容 ...
引用一、将程序布署到Linux前我们需要一些准备工作: 1、首先安装Linux系统并配置好登录用户名和密码 2、然后在linux系统配置一个FTP(VFTP),用于上传安装文件。 3、最后打开Linux的SSH服务(打开SSH以后,可以借助一些工具远程连接Linux操作,而不     必直接在Linux服务器操作。现实中Linux服务器在机房中...) 4、检查Linux服务器防火墙 相关命令如下: 1、配置用户 root/123456 [root@localhost ~]# chmod 755 文件 (配置用户对文件权限) 2、配置F ...
1、创建 一个包含native方法的类 public class HelloWorld { /** * Declare native method */ private native void displayHelloWorld(); /** * * Static piece */ static{ System.loadLibrary("hello") ; } /** * Main test * @param args */ public static void ...

Java num example

    博客分类:
  • Java
在此之前我们定义常量的时候,一般都是写在接口或者类里;现在让我们了解一下Java枚举,从开发中总结了一下Java枚举,以实例为据。JDk1.5之后引入了枚举类型,枚举定的如下: 引用[public] enum 枚举名称{   枚举对象1,枚举对象2,...,枚举对象N ; } 引用1)枚举对象的定义必须要存在相应的构造方法相对应,如1对1,2对2,3对3 2)构造方法必须是private package cn.enu; /** * JDk1.5之后引入了枚举类型,枚举定的如下: * [public] enum 枚举名称{ * 枚举对象1,枚举对象2,...,枚举对象N ...
1 - Tomcat Server的组成部分 1.1 - Server A Server element represents the entire Catalina servlet container. (Singleton) 1.2 - Service A Service element represents the combination of one or more Connector components that share a single Engine Service是这样一个集合:它由一个或 ...
     如果要比较两个对象则Comparable接口很实用,虽然还有另一个接口Comparator,但我们现在只介绍接口Comparable用法。比较两个对象先要实现接口Comparable,并且实现compareTo方法,建议compareTo与equals比较规则一样。compareTo方法定义,查看API文档(文档已详细说明),实例结合java.util.Arrays.sort()方法。下面提供实例说明: package cn.lang; /** * <li>当且仅当 e1.compareTo(e2) == 0 与 e1.equals(e2) 具有相同的 boo ...
很实用几个例子,在Java开发中,灵活运用可以解决很多问题,比如说持久化实现,还可以配合Struts拦截器解决权限问题,可以控制到方法。 package cn.annotation; /** * Define Annotation key words is '@interface' so as class * If you don't set defau ...

Java泛型

    博客分类:
  • Java
     Java泛型是JDK1.5中添加的支持的,所以在JDK1.5之前的版本是没有些功能。泛型就是在对象建立时不指明类中属性的具体类型,而是由外部在声明及实例化对象时指定类型。泛型可以解决数据类型安全性问题。 一、泛型基本 ...
Global site tag (gtag.js) - Google Analytics